Haduohe area located in the north greater hinggan mountains,in the Erlian-heihesuture zone which between the Xing’an block and Songnen block.At present, exist thefollowing three questions about the granitic mylonite in Haduohe area.First, thegranitic mylonite in Haduohe area was divided into Xinsheng group(C3-P1)x by thegeological map of1:200000Zhalaiteqi (1972), but after a field geologicalinvestigation and petrographic analysis, the rock combination is mainly a set ofmetamorphic deformation granitic rocks. Second, the present reseach on thechronology and rock geochemistry evidence of granitic mylonite in Haduohe area isin lack. Third, whether the magmatic origin and metamorphic deformation of thegranitic mylonite in Haduohe area was affected by the Erlian-heihe suture zone. Basedon the above three points,this paper study on the granitic mylonite in Haduohe areafrom the aspects of lithology, chronology and rock geochemical, find out the rockcombination and fabric characteristics, protolith formation age, analyzes the rockgeochemical characteristics, and discuss the protolith types and the tectonicbackground, also to explore the petrogenesis and dynamic metamorphism deformationage.1. The rock combination of the granitic mylonite in Haduohe areaThe petrographical facies studies indicate that the granitic mylonite in Haduohearea has mylonitic texture, augen structure or gneissic structure,and containing a fewnew metamorphic minerals,just as biotite, muscovite and Garnet. Confirm the rockcombination is fine grained biotite monzonitic granitic mylonite, fine grained biotitegranitic mylonite, fine grained garnet mica granitic mylonite, fine grained epidotebiotite granitic mylonite, fine grained biotite hornblende monzonitic granitic mylonite,fine grained epidote monzonitic granitic mylonite, fine grained actynolin biotitegranitic mylonite and Fine grained alkali granitic mylonite. 2. The geochemical characteristics of the granitic mylonite in Haduohe areaThe granitic mylonite in Haduohe area has66.4%~77.0%SiO2,and12.12%~16%Al2O3,low Mg[w(MgO)=0.2%~1.89%],δ=1.8~3.12(δ<3.3),A/CNK=0.93~1.093(<1.1). The total amount of rare earth elements is not high (ΣREE=57.17×10-6~144.37×10-6), rich light rare earth elements and depleted heavy ones, and areenriched in LILE, such as Rb,Ba,U, K, etc., depleted in HFSE, such as Ta,Nb, P, Ti,etc.,and shows a weak negative Eu anomalies (δEu=0.33~1.12). Integrated studyindicates that it’s metaluminous to peraluminuous rocks,and typical high-Kcalc-alkaline I type granite. the nature of original rocks is orthometamorphite.3. The age of the protolith of the granitic mylonite in Haduohe areaZircon U-Pb dating shows that the weighted average age of the granitic mylonitein Haduohe area is303.7±2.5Ma、305.8±1.9Ma、319.1±2.1Ma and320.3±1.9Ma,shows the magma formation age is late carboniferous, and it can be characterized bytwo periods, the first period is around320Ma, the representative rock is fine grainedbiotite granitic mylonite and fine garnet mica granitic mylonite, the second period isaround303Ma, the representative rock is fine grained biotite monzonitic graniticmylonite.4. The causes of the granitic mylonite in Haduohe areaThe granitic mylonite in Haduohe area were formed in the post-collisionenvironment of Xing’an block and Songnen block in Late Carboniferous, and sufferedrelatively strong ductile brittle metamorphism and deformation in Late Early Permianby the post-collision of Xing’an block and Songnen block.
